Relentless Pacers overrun Knicks to set up NBA finals showdown with Thunder

Game Highlights

Pascal Siakam and Tyrese Haliburton led the Indiana Pacers to a commanding 125-108 victory over the New York Knicks, securing a 4-2 series win and paving their way to the NBA finals for the first time since 2000.

Key Performances

Pascal Siakam was phenomenal, scoring 31 points, and was rightfully named the Eastern Conference finals MVP. Tyrese Haliburton also played a crucial role, especially in the fourth quarter, adding 21 points to the scoreboard. Together, they ensured the Pacers’ victory and set the stage for their next big challenge.

Turning Point

The game saw a significant turn after halftime with the Pacers launching a 9-0 run, which shifted the momentum entirely in their favor and deflated the Knicks’ spirits.

Opponent’s Struggle

The New York Knicks struggled with turnovers throughout the game, totaling 17, which contributed significantly to their loss. Despite efforts from key players like Karl-Anthony Towns and Jalen Brunson, the Knicks could not capitalize on crucial moments.

Upcoming NBA Finals

With this victory, the Pacers are set to face the Oklahoma City Thunder in the NBA finals starting Thursday. This marks only the second time in franchise history that the Pacers have reached the finals, promising an exciting series ahead.

Coach’s Insight

Coach Rick Carlisle expressed his pride in the team’s performance but reminded everyone that their journey isn’t over. “Our work has just begun,” he stated, preparing his team for the challenges of the upcoming NBA finals.
